Step Right up To A New Life. Joshua 4:1-24 Because of their unbelief, Israel was sentenced to wander in the wilderness for 40 years. Those years have now expired, and the children of Israel are poised to enter Canaan Land to finally receive the success of victory. They are ready to claim their inheritance in the land of promise. However, before they can enter Canaan, they must first get past one final, major obstacle: the Jordan River. Normally, this would not have presented much of a problem since the Jordan was only 100 feet wide at Gilgal where they crossed. However, it seems that God always does things in such a way that no man can boast of having done them on their own. This crossing would be no exception. You see, God brought them to the Jordan River at the time of harvest, 4:15. Those who have been there during the harvest time tell us that the Jordan swells to an impassable width of over 1 mile! It was over 50 times wider than it normally would have been when Israel arrived. There was no way they could cross this river on their own! They needed supernatural help. My friends, we each have Jordan's that we face from time to time! When we look at the obstacles that stand between us and spiritual victory in our own Canaan, we may feel that we will never be able to enter our Canaan of victory and enjoy the abundant life that Jesus promised His followers. Well, it is true that I do not know what kind of obstacles that you face in your life, I know a God Who specializes in the Success of overcoming the overwhelming and in leading His children to victory.
